研究目的
To review various analytical results obtained by the method of separating rapid and slow subsystems for various polarizations of the laser field, focusing on the behavior of atoms under a high-frequency laser field.
研究成果
The paper concludes that the method of separating rapid and slow subsystems provides accurate analytical results for hydrogen atoms in a high-frequency laser field, revealing hidden symmetries and celestial analogies. It highlights the advantages of this method and its potential for understanding the transition to chaos.
研究不足
The paper focuses on analytical results and does not cover numerical methods or experimental validations. It also does not address the transition to chaos in detail.
